Our Seattle Light tree pruning service includes several key tasks aimed at improving your trees’ health and appearance. We focus on:
- Trimming and Shaping: Removing dead or diseased branches, shaping trees to encourage healthy growth, and promoting proper air circulation.
- Thinning: Reducing the density of branches to allow more sunlight to reach the interior of the tree, which is essential for overall vitality.
- Cleaning: Clearing away debris, such as fallen branches and leaves, to ensure your property remains tidy and inviting.
- Inspection: Evaluating the health of your trees to catch potential issues early, such as pest infestations or diseases.

What is the cost of tree pruning?
Prices range from $200 to $600 based on various factors.How often should I prune my trees?
Most trees benefit from pruning every 1-3 years, depending on their growth rate.Are there any additional fees?
We aim for transparency—any extra charges will be discussed before service.Can I schedule a pruning service at any time?
While we can accommodate most requests, ideal times are typically in early spring or late fall.What if my tree is damaged?
We assess the situation and provide recommendations, including possible removal if necessary.
